  • Unable to create tables through dbms_sql

    Hai
    I got the below error when i am createing table through dbms_sql package at any user except sys user.Our database is 8.1.6 standard edition
    SQL>CONNECT MOHAN/MOHAN;
    SQL> CREATE OR REPLACE Procedure EXECUTESQL (SQLStatement IN VARCHAR2) IS cursor
    _name INTEGER; ret
    2 INTEGER; BEGIN cursor_name := DBMS_SQL.OPEN_CURSOR; DBMS_SQL.PARSE(cursor_n
    ame, SQLStatement,
    3 DBMS_SQL.native); ret := DBMS_SQL.Execute(cursor_name); DBMS_SQL.CLOSE_CURS
    OR(cursor_name); END;
    4 /
    Procedure created.
    SQL> exec EXECUTESQL('create table test(name number)');
    BEGIN EXECUTESQL('create table test(name number)'); END;
    ERROR at line 1:
    ORA-01031: insufficient privileges
    ORA-06512: at "SYS.DBMS_SYS_SQL", line 782
    ORA-06512: at "SYS.DBMS_SQL", line 32
    ORA-06512: at "MOHAN.EXECUTESQL", line 2
    ORA-06512: at line 1
    Any idea about that
    Thanks in advance
    mohan

    Since you are using Oracle 8.1.6, you can use EXECUTE IMMEDIATE instead of DBMS_SQL. Make sure that the necessary privileges have been granted directly, not through roles. Click on the link below for more about privileges and roles and the error message that you got:
    http://osi.oracle.com/~tkyte/Misc/RolesAndProcedures.html
    Once you have the privileges granted properly, you should be able to use the code below. I should point out that this is still doing things the hard way. You can just issue the create table statement from the SQL prompt. I must assume that this is just a minimal experiment and that the eventual code involves more.
    SQL> CREATE OR REPLACE PROCEDURE executesql
      2    (SQLStatement IN VARCHAR2)
      3  IS
      4  BEGIN
      5    EXECUTE IMMEDIATE SQLStatement;
      6  END executesql;
      7  /
    Procedure created.
    SQL> EXEC executesql ('CREATE TABLE test (name NUMBER)')
    PL/SQL procedure successfully completed.
    SQL> DESC test
    Name                                      Null?    Type
    NAME                                               NUMBER
